Heading the 2008 Parade was LORRAINE CANNON who is our UK Co-ordinator

Lorraine leads the team in the UK with great compassion and calm efficiency. She has a very wise head on her young shoulders and is responsible for making all final decisions as well as finding the very best homes for the Golden Retrievers who come to us. She has great intuition, good people skills and is very thorough. She dedicates a huge amount of her free time to IRR as finding the right person / family often involves her having lengthy telephone conversations with prospective adopters prior to home checking and sometimes again afterwards but she will always do her best to find the perfect match for every dog.

She has a particular soft spot for the oldies….first losing her heart to her beloved Darcy and then to OLD SAM who, despite his possible 15yrs of age, still has a determination to match that of his mammy.

Stella is the matriarch of an ever increasing family. Belinda and Terry specialise in the successful rehabilitation of traumatised ex-breeding bitches and sometimes their puppies. Foster dogs at their house, apart from their suitability for living with other dogs, are also tested for their cat and chicken friendliness.
